Most self-help books focus on a single topic - a problem,
disorder, or life-change goal - and offer readers strategies
designed to help them make progress on whatever that topic might
be. If you're depressed, get a book on depression. Afraid of
heights? There's a book just for you. But the fact is that human
problems rarely boil down to a single topic: Few of us are ever
just depressed, just anxious, or just inclined to eat too much at
dinner. It's far more likely that we want to shake the blues and
stop worrying about the bills and learn how to be develop healthy
eating habits, and ...the list goes on. Fortunately, some self-help
books take a broader approach, one that is as comprehensive and
flexible as the problems we all struggle with every day. "Thoughts
and Feelings" is such a book. It adapts the powerful and widely
adaptable techniques of cognitive behavioural therapy (CBT) into a
set of tools readers can use, not to solve a particular problem,
but to overcome any of the emotional and behavioural changes that
life throws their way. CBT recognizes that most negative feelings
arise from confused, irrational thoughts.By learning to identify
and change these thoughts and by replacing destructive and limiting
behaviors with new, more constructive ones, readers can start
steering their lives in the direction they want to go. Changes to
this new edition include revisions and updates to the core CBT
chapters as well as a new chapter on how to use mindfulness to
bring focus and intention to the process of change.
